Built in 1852, the Union Hotel is a living reminder of Benicia’s history as a way station during the Gold Rush. Well known for paranormal phenomena and the legends of ghosts, the hotel is frequently visited by enthusiasts looking for a glimpse of “Crying Mary” — a former “lady of the evening” who is still mourning the loss of one of her customers. The restaurant is a hub of activity, complete with a beautiful side patio and plenty of outdoor sidewalk dining. The elegant bar inside is a charming step back into the past. Gabriel Oviedo, “Gabby,” is well known to Benicia locals and has been the restaurant owner and chef for more than 18 years. Friendly and accommodating, Gabby makes a mean martini and provides fresh and creative selections. Of French, Spanish, and Italian heritage, Gabby was born in Mexico. His menu is a reflection of styles from multiple regions. Each dish has a unique twist — Fettuccini with filet mignon in brandy cream sauce, Lamb Chops in citrus olive oil or the fresh grilled Halibut. Homemade pasta and bread. Don’t miss the very popular Italian style crispy pizzas. Desserts? Oh, yeah!
